SOUTHFIELD, Mich.- The Calvin ACHA Division 3 hockey team lost 3-0 at Lawrence Tech University Saturday evening after winning the first leg of the double header at home on Friday night. The Knights are now 2-2 on the year.
Â
It took both teams an entire period to find their footing. Neither team scored in the first period, leaving the period both start and end at 0-0.
Â
Devin Genzel would be the first player to make something happen one-and-a-half minutes into the 2nd period. Tech increased its lead in the 2nd period when Connor Juhasz scored with 12:36 left in the 2nd. The period ended with Tech up 2-0.
Â
In the 3rd period Tech increased its lead to 3 when Connor Juhasz scored his 2nd goal of the game with 3:18 left in the game. No further goals were scored and Lawrence Tech got its revenge after losing to Calvin the previous night.
Â
COACHES COMMENT: Head Coach Austin Huizenga-"LTU played a solid game and made the right adjustments. We weren't able to get ourselves going. Credit to LTU."
